Standard entrance requirements

Our minimum entrance requirements are:

  • For Postgraduate Diplomas and Certificates, Master’s degrees: You should normally have (or expect to be awarded) an undergraduate degree of at least second class standard in a relevant subject.
  • For MRes programmes: You should normally have (or expect to be awarded) an undergraduate degree of at least upper second class standard.
  • For MPhil/PhD programmes: You should normally have (or expect to be awarded) a taught Master’s in a relevant subject area.

If your degree is in an unrelated field, you may also be considered, subject to a qualifying examination; we may ask any applicant to take this examination. You might also be considered for some programmes if you aren’t a graduate, but have relevant experience and can show that you have the ability to work at postgraduate level.

We also accept a wide range of international equivalent qualifications. If you would like more information, please contact the Admissions Office; if you're an international applicant you can visit our country-specific pages for further details.
